Title :
A control strategy for the optimal efficiency of induction motor based on loss model and fuzzy search

Abstract :
At the rated load, the efficiency of vector controlled induction motor is usually high. However at the light load, the efficiency is low and there is significant margins for efficiency improvement. In this paper, in order to improve efficiency a hybrid control strategy is proposed, which is based on the combination of loss model and fuzzy search. At the steady-state light-load condition, the initial value of the optimal flux is obtained by the loss model of motor, and then a fuzzy search in a certain range around the initial flux value is applied to determine the practical optimal flux. The simulation results show that the proposed control strategy is effective.
